Transaction 677084902cfabdba3a7ddba05df797eae86f76ebaef95cf8854140afd056616b
1 Input
1 Output
-
677084902cfabdba3a7ddba05df797eae86f76ebaef95cf8854140afd056616b:0
- value
- 273796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82a5f090963b6357619578ad77a5d0e4f86ca8af OP_EQUAL
- address
- 3DbpZB5hDNEav1gs4MaURyQY8TaUDJiBAB